DRUID ISLES SUBDIVISION is one of 3,067 community water systems in Florida in the 500 or fewer people size category, formerly serving 182 people from groundwater.

EPA's federal records list this system as inactive in 1999; the record below is historical.

As of August 1, 2026, its federal record holds 2 entries in 1999, all of which EPA lists as closed. Nothing has been added since 1999.

All 2 are monitoring and reporting requirements — the category that accounts for about four in five of all violations in EPA's national dataset — rather than findings about the water itself. The record involves the Total Coliform Rules.
